Is Reuniclus Good in Black 2 & White 2 Playthrough?

Psychic at level 41 with AbilityMagic Guard. Transfer only. If imported, enormous HP and Sp. Atk with zero indirect damage. Handles Marshal and contributes everywhere Psychic is useful. The best Unova Psychic if you can get one.

Reuniclus Weakness

Reuniclus's Psychic typing leaves it vulnerable to Bug, Ghost, and Dark. With 110 HP and balanced defenses, Reuniclus can afford to eat a neutral hit or two.

Reuniclus Black 2 & White 2 Guide

  • In Black 2 & White 2, Don't let Reuniclus's 490 base stat total fool you. Magic Guard is what makes it tick. It punches way above its weight class. We rate it B-Tier as a wallbreaker. Recover with Leftovers is the standard set.

  • In Black 2 & White 2, watch for Scizor (Bug), Gengar (Ghost), and Houndoom (Dark) when using Reuniclus. They all hit it super-effectively with STAB. At base 30 Speed, Reuniclus won't outrun any of these threats so switching to a resist is usually the safer play.

  • In Black 2 & White 2, Run Magic Guard on Reuniclus. It's the ability that defines how you build around it and the main reason it holds a competitive niche. Reuniclus also gets Overcoat and Regenerator, but they don't compare.

  • In Black 2 & White 2, Reuniclus fills the wallbreaker role. It's a special attacker with base 125 Sp. Atk. Base 30 Speed is low. Priority moves or Trick Room are the way to go. And it's enough bulk to take a hit or two.
